Civil Rights, Justice and Inclusion
In this course we will consider the experience of The Episcopal Church (TEC) during the eras of the African American Civil Rights movement, as well as the struggle to accept women as leaders in every order of ministry. Additionally, we will consider the experience and witness of sexual (GLBT) and cultural (Asian American, Native/Indigenous and Hispanic/Latino) minority communities within TEC. Participants in the course will gain a richer appreciation and understanding of the experiences which have influenced some of TEC's present realities while better articulating personal thoughts and questions about the life and mission of the Church.
